摘要
MM1-16003P塑壳断路器是电力系统中重要的电气保护设备,其性能会影响电力设备的安全性和可靠性。文章针对MM1-16003P塑壳断路器的制造工艺提出一系列优化措施以及质量控制方案。优化措施包含改进材料选择和采用精密模具设计,提升装配工艺的精细化和自动化水平,推动测试环节的标准化与智能化。质量控制方面,建立完善的质量控制体系,强化关键工序的质量检测与控制,应用智能监控技术进行生产过程实时监测,制订风险识别与预防措施。这些优化方案和质量控制措施有助于提升MM1-16003P塑壳断路器的制造质量,保证其长期稳定运行,可有效降低生产过程中出现的质量波动,为断路器制造行业提供一定的借鉴意义。
